[QUOTE="flydl2atl, post: 774022, member: 18355"]Why not go rob a bank instead of preying on the poor by getting them to sell their house for below market value. Moreover, as a someone who owns a rental condo - I can tell you that rental properties are not all they are cracked up to be and the return isn't really that great. And since housing on average is still unafforadable (historical average is 2.5-3X average income) - there is the potential for further downside - so you may end up with negative cashflow. Given the record amount of debt at the consumer, business, and government level a strong case can be made for investing in bullion coins. The fact that people look back and talk about how great stocks or real estate has no bearing on what's best in the future. The best course of action is to diversify and focus on preserving your wealth instead of focusing on getting a great return - so yes invest in some bullion coins...buy stocks that have a solid recession proof business model...keep some close in cds at a credit union etc.... And always invest in the lives of others. Good Luck![/QUOTE]
